This content is protected WBO super flyweight champion Fernando Montiel has offered Z The Dream Gorres a rematch. www.insidesports.ph has learned that the rematch offer was made by international matchmaker Sampson Lewkowicz and coursed to the Gorres handlers led by the respected father-and-son team of Tony and Michael Aldeguer of the famed ALA Gym. We also understand that the handlers would meet this afternoon to study the offer for the rematch which will be part of the big Top Rank fight card at the plush Venetian in Macau which will also feature IBF flyweight champion Nonito The Filipino Flash Donaire in a mandatory title defense against South Africas Moruti Mthalane. Top Rank promoter Bob Arum himself told us some time ago that Jorge Arce would also see action on the same card on October 11 as well as North American Boxing Federation super bantamweight champion Bernabe Concepcion.
